#642fdd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#642fdd is composed of 39.2% red, 18.4%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.8% cyan, 78.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 258.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 52.5%. #642fdd color hex could be obtained by blending #c85eff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#642fdd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05020b is the darkest color, while #fbf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#642fdd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858389 is the less saturated color, while #5913f9 is the most saturated one.
